在MongoDB中,可以使用sort()方法对集合中的文档按照不同的值进行排序。下面是一个包含代码示例的解决方法:
db.collection.find().sort({field: 1})
db.collection.find().sort({field: -1})
db.collection.find().sort({field1: 1, field2: -1})
db.collection.find().sort({"nestedField.field": 1})
在上述代码示例中,db.collection代表要排序的集合名称,field代表要排序的字段名称,1表示升序排序,-1表示降序排序。
需要注意的是,sort()方法返回一个排序后的游标,如果想要获取排序后的结果,可以调用toArray()方法将游标转换为数组。
希望以上解决方法对你有帮助!
上一篇:按不同条件创建分隔符字符串
下一篇:按不同字段排序的SQL